Key Insights of Japan Closed Loop Stepper Motor System Market

  • Market size estimated at approximately $1.2 billion in 2023, with a robust CAGR forecast of 8.5% through 2033.
  • Dominance of industrial automation applications, especially robotics and CNC machinery, accounting for over 60% of revenue share.
  • Leading segment: High-precision, energy-efficient closed loop systems tailored for semiconductor manufacturing and medical devices.
  • Geographically, Japan holds over 50% of the Asia-Pacific market share, driven by advanced manufacturing infrastructure and innovation hubs.
  • Key growth drivers include rising adoption of Industry 4.0, government incentives for automation, and increasing demand for miniaturized, smart motor solutions.
  • Major players: Panasonic, Nidec, Mitsubishi Electric, Yaskawa, and Oriental Motor, focusing on technological innovation and strategic alliances.

Dynamic Market Forces and Competitive Analysis of Japan’s Closed Loop Stepper Motor Market

Porter’s Five Forces analysis reveals a highly competitive environment with significant supplier power due to specialized component needs and limited local suppliers. Buyer power is moderate, driven by OEMs’ demand for customized, high-performance solutions. Threat of new entrants remains moderate owing to high R&D costs and stringent standards, but technological barriers favor established players. Substitutes, such as linear motors and other advanced actuation systems, pose a threat in specific applications, emphasizing the need for continuous innovation.

Competitive rivalry is intense, with key players investing heavily in R&D to develop smarter, more efficient systems. Strategic partnerships and joint ventures are common to leverage local expertise and expand market reach. The industry’s profitability is influenced by technological differentiation, regulatory compliance, and supply chain resilience. Overall, the market’s future will be shaped by innovation cycles, customer demands for miniaturization, and the integration of AI and IoT technologies, creating both challenges and opportunities for incumbents and new entrants alike.
